Last Updated: Sep 11, 2025 (UTC)Inox India: Mixed Signals in September
Detailed Analysis
- On September 4, 2025, Inox India reported its Q1 FY2025 financial results, showing a 14.58% year-over-year increase in total income to ₹339.62 Crore. Operating profit also grew, rising 6.15% to ₹68.57 Crore, and profit after tax increased by 16.11% to ₹61.12 Crore. However, the operating margin decreased by 7.36% to 20.19%, indicating potential cost pressures despite revenue growth.
- Despite the positive Q1 results, Inox India's stock price experienced volatility. On September 2, 2025, it traded at ₹1151.80, down 1.93%, with short-term targets set at a downside of ₹1127 and an upside of ₹1170.8. By September 11, 2025, the price had fallen further to ₹1170.75, a 0.94% decrease from the previous close.
- Insider ownership remains remarkably high at approximately 75% as of September 4, 2025, representing a ₹107 billion market capitalization. The top two shareholders control 52% of the company, while institutional ownership stands at 12%. This concentration of ownership suggests strong alignment with long-term success but also potential risks.
- Investor relations were active throughout the month, with scheduled meetings with Axis Capital (September 11, 2025) and Envision Capital (September 11, 2025). A plant visit with Monarch Networth Capital, originally scheduled for September 4, 2025, was unfortunately cancelled.
- Inox Clean Energy, the renewable arm of Inox, expanded its portfolio on September 11, 2025, by acquiring a 640 MW wind-solar hybrid project portfolio from Evergreen Group. This portfolio includes five projects in Maharashtra, contracted under tenders by SJVN and NTPC, signaling a commitment to growth in the renewable energy sector.
